is now present at the Part Tracker, but the TEXMAP pattern is not visible from behind, when I use it in LDCad, on a transparent part.


Is it possible to combine a TEXMAP pattern with a BFC NOCLIP ?
If so, how should a correct file syntax look like?

First of all, please note that the same thing happens in LDView. In LDView, it's definitely due to a bug. (Unfortunately, it's a bug that would take a VERY long time to fix, and probably won't be fixed.) The bug in LDView is that LDView doesn't support TEXMAPs being applied to transparent surfaces, so the surface the texture is on is opaque. The reason that this relates to BFC is that in LDView, BFC is never applied to transparent surfaces. So if it weren't for this bug, the texture would be visible from the back side in LDView.

I'm not sure what happens in LDCad. It could be that LDCad applies BFC to transparent surfaces. If so, I would argue that that is a bug. It also could be that LDCad doesn't support TEXMAP on transparent surfaces. That would also be a bug.

The following might work, but isn't appropriate in an official file, since the disappearing texture is due to a renderer bug and not a part bug:

Code:
0 Dish  4 x  4 Inverted with White and Aqua Swirl Pattern
0 Name: 3960p0b.dat
0 Author: Philippe Hurbain [Philo]
0 !LDRAW_ORG Unofficial_Part
0 !LICENSE Redistributable under CCAL version 2.0 : see CAreadme.txt

0 BFC CERTIFY CW

0 !KEYWORDS Round, Elves

1 16 0 0 0 1 0 0 0 1 0 0 0 1 s\3960s01.dat
0 !TEXMAP START PLANAR -40 0 40 40 0 40 -40 0 -40 3960p0b.png
0 !: 1 16 0 0 0 1 0 0 0 1 0 0 0 1 s\3960s03.dat
0 !: 0 BFC INVERTNEXT
0 !: 1 16 0 0 0 1 0 0 0 1 0 0 0 1 s\3960s03.dat
0 !TEXMAP FALLBACK
1 15 0 0 0 1 0 0 0 1 0 0 0 1 s\3960p2b.dat
1 16 0 0 0 1 0 0 0 1 0 0 0 1 s\3960p2a.dat
0 !TEXMAP END

For reasons that I don't understand, the above doesn't work in LDView. I will be investigating that. What it's supposed to do is include a second copy of the textured geometry, and have that second copy face the opposite direction. It doesn't work, and I don't yet know why.
